Please follow these instructions fully to be considered for this climb. Send your request using the Request Leader’s Permission link on this page between June 12 and June 14; the order that requests are received during this period does not matter. In your request, please tell me about your recent conditioning and recent hikes/scrambles/climbs you have done.
I aim to fill the roster and waitlist by June 17 with a 1:3 graduate:student ratio. Among students, priority will be given to students who have not yet completed a basic glacier climb and are not on the roster for an upcoming one. If needed, participants will be selected at random, up to a maximum waitlist size of 6.
Thank you for your interest! Due to the volume of requests, I may not be able to personally reply to each one.
Rope leaders, you may contact me at any time from May 1.

Required Equipment
- The Ten Essentials
- Mountain boots that can accept crampons (not hiking boots)
- Crampons
- An ice axe (not technical ice tools)
- A sleeping bag rated to +20 degrees or colder
- A sleeping pad
- A back pack (40 to 60 liters)
- Webbing and accessory cords
- 6 straight gate carabiners
- 2 locking carabiners
- Large pear-shaped carabiner
- Belay device
- Climbing harness
- Helmet
- Rescue pulley
- Fleece or puffy jacket
- Rain jacket and full-zip rain pants
- Warm gloves or mittens
